The main application scenarios and benefits of AR in ironmaking intelligent operation and maintenance

  The steel industry is in a critical period of digital transformation and upgrading. The emergence of the industrial metaverse technology represented by AR will bring a new path for the intelligent upgrading of the steel industry. From Made in China to "Smart" Made in China, new technologies of digital intelligence are helping traditional enterprises to transform and upgrade.

  AR remote assistance technology is a technology that combines the real world and the virtual world. It can superimpose virtual information on the real scene to provide instant assistance and guidance. In steel production enterprises, AR remote assistance technology can provide enterprises with various conveniences.

  After the first-line maintenance personnel arrive at the scene, they can check the equipment maintenance records in real time and quickly trace the historical problems of the equipment. When encountering problems that are difficult to solve, maintenance personnel can call technical experts through remote collaboration, and through remote collaboration capabilities such as first-person perspective sharing, AR annotation, real-time audio and video communication, and electronic whiteboards, they can accurately handle exceptions and reduce equipment non-stop time. Improve the availability and reliability of equipment, and improve the timeliness of problem solving.

  Based on the deployed AR remote expert guidance system, maintenance workers can initiate audio and video calls with remote experts by wearing AR glasses, and collect and share the first-person view of the scene in real time. At the same time, experts can guide on-site workers to complete equipment installation, commissioning, repair and maintenance through functions such as voice guidance, screen annotation, and shared whiteboard based on the images collected on-site.

  Enable remote training

  AR remote assistance technology can present the guidance and training materials of remote experts to students in real time through 3D simulation technology, allowing students to conduct interactive learning in real scenes and apply them in real time.

  cut costs

  In the traditional steel production process, if it is necessary to dispatch professionals to the site for maintenance or debugging, it will take a lot of time and travel costs. And AR remote assistance technology can provide instant assistance and guidance remotely, reducing the cost of enterprises.

  Improve efficiency

  AR remote assistance technology can provide guidance and assistance remotely by professionals to help on-site staff perform maintenance or debugging, improve efficiency, reduce maintenance or debugging time, and shorten production cycles.

  increase security

  There are certain safety risks in iron and steel production enterprises. The use of AR remote assistance technology can give timely warnings when staff make mistakes, and give danger reminders before operations to increase the safety of maintenance.

  "Compared with traditional video and voice calls, 5G+AR technology has the advantages of multi-person collaboration, convenient resource call, and accurate restoration of the scene, which will greatly improve work efficiency and reduce costs." Technician Lu Zhiqiang said, “When there are problems with the equipment that are difficult to solve, you can contact technical personnel at home and abroad for guidance through 5G+AR smart glasses. After troubleshooting, the work content can be saved as a video case, and data analysis reports can be obtained in real time for continuous improvement. Production process..." The successful application of 5G+AR technology has solved the pain points of the steel industry, such as "can't go, not enough people, unclear, difficult to cooperate", and provided a new solution for the industry to accelerate digital transformation.

  The AR remote expert guidance system can not only save customers' travel support costs, but also improve the efficiency of equipment maintenance and maintenance, improve the production efficiency of enterprises in disguise, and achieve cost reduction and efficiency increase.
